Airbus Defense and Space has begun working with the Beacon project, a collaborative R&D project that focuses on the development of various photonic technologies for the future of high-capacity, energy efficient telecommunication satellites.

As part of the project, Airbus DS will study the use of terrestrial photonics and fiber optic technologies with future spacecraft, and how these could save mass and increase capacity on high-throughput satellites. Airbus will also look at enabling future telecommunication satellites to be more energy efficient than existing repeater systems.

Co-funded by the European Union, the Beacon project enlists the work of companies and research centers in the design and development of technologies such as high-speed electro-optic modulator arrays for RF processing, radiation-hardened optical amplifier arrays, and multi-beam silicon photonic integrated beam-formers.

electro-optic modulator
An electro-optic modulator (EOM) is a device used to modulate the amplitude, phase, or polarization of light waves using an external electrical signal.
